Is Acute Lymphocytic Leukemia (ALL) Serious?
ALL, characterized by the rapid proliferation of immature lymphoid cells, is undeniably a serious medical condition. The gravity of the disease lies in its swift progression and the potential to infiltrate vital organs. The symptoms, including fatigue, easy bruising, and recurrent infections, are often subtle in the initial stages, leading to delayed diagnosis.
Untreated, ALL can compromise the normal production of red blood cells, platelets, and healthy white blood cells. This not only weakens the immune system but also exposes patients to life-threatening complications such as hemorrhage and severe infections. The seriousness of ALL necessitates prompt and aggressive intervention to optimize the chances of remission and long-term survival.
How Common are Acute Lymphocytic Leukemia (ALL)?
While ALL constitutes a significant portion of leukemia cases, it is comparatively rare in the broader context of cancer. According to recent statistics, ALL comprises approximately 20% of all leukemia cases, with an annual incidence of about 1.7 cases per 100,000 people. The prevalence is higher in children, constituting the most common form of leukemia in this age group. However, ALL can affect individuals of any age, and its occurrence peaks in early childhood and after the age of 50.

Who are the Doctors Who Treat Acute Lymphocytic Leukemia (ALL)?
The multidisciplinary approach to treating ALL involves a team of specialized healthcare professionals. Hematologists, oncologists, and hematologist-oncologists are at the forefront of managing ALL cases. These physicians possess extensive expertise in blood disorders and cancer, enabling them to navigate the complexities of ALL diagnosis, treatment, and follow-up care.
Pediatric hematologist-oncologists play a crucial role in the management of ALL in children, emphasizing the unique challenges and considerations in the pediatric population. Additionally, the involvement of pathologists, radiologists, and bone marrow transplant specialists contributes to a comprehensive and integrated approach to ALL care.
What is the Drug of Choice for Acute Lymphocytic Leukemia (ALL)?
The treatment landscape for ALL has evolved significantly over the years, with chemotherapy remaining a cornerstone. The induction phase typically involves a combination of chemotherapeutic agents to eliminate leukemic cells and induce remission. Methotrexate, vincristine, and corticosteroids are commonly used during this phase.
For certain subtypes of ALL, targeted therapies such as tyrosine kinase inhibitors may be employed. Immunotherapy, particularly chimeric antigen receptor T-cell (CAR-T) therapy, has emerged as a revolutionary approach, harnessing the patient's immune system to target and destroy cancer cells.
The choice of the drug or combination of drugs depends on factors such as the patient's age, overall health, subtype of ALL, and specific genetic characteristics of the leukemia cells. Treatment decisions are highly individualized, underscoring the importance of a personalized and tailored approach to ALL management.
What Post-Treatment Follow-Up is Needed?
The conclusion of active treatment for ALL does not mark the end of the medical journey. Post-treatment follow-up is integral to monitor for potential relapse, manage treatment-related side effects, and address the psychosocial aspects of survivorship.
Regular medical check-ups, blood tests, and imaging studies form the foundation of post-treatment surveillance. The frequency and intensity of follow-up appointments may vary based on individual factors and the specific treatment received. Long-term side effects of chemotherapy, such as cardiac or endocrine complications, may require ongoing monitoring and intervention.
Psychosocial support is equally critical in the post-treatment phase. Survivors of ALL may contend with emotional and psychological challenges, necessitating the involvement of counselors, support groups, and rehabilitation services.
